Team Handball

The middle school is learning the game Team Handball. This is a fast paced game with a lot of passing and teamwork.

2-3's

The 2-3 class has been working on foot eye coordination. Controlling a Soccer Ball without using their hands is something that the 2-3's have been working really hard on. We have been practicing these skills by playing Soccer Shipwreck, Keep Away, and Knockout. These games help the class have better ball handling skills.

K-1 & 2-3

K-1's and 2-3's really enjoy the Soccer Shipwreck game. This game focuses on ball control and helps students gain more foot eye coordination. The best Shipwreck Command is "Seasick" this command make the crew on the ship get "seasick". The kids really have some fun with this game.
